Output 839f0b51948a6063d13b2234583339fe22ddd04fb16c7d1f051befb107c74777:4

value
166811
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e31644d43838fd29e00a43ad34b4860a248e310 OP_EQUAL
address
35uGBArLXaHAWmrrqAAvWCarnFTUEdvqK2
transaction
839f0b51948a6063d13b2234583339fe22ddd04fb16c7d1f051befb107c74777
confirmations
224345
spent
true